ProfiniteGrp.limitConePtAux
{J : Type v} →
[inst : CategoryTheory.SmallCategory J] →
(F : CategoryTheory.Functor J ProfiniteGrp.{max v u}) → Subgroup ((j : J) → ↑(F.obj j).toProfinite.toTop)Auxiliary construction to obtain the group structure on the limit of profinite groups.
